Main Components of an Inventory Management System in Excel
Building an effective inventory management system in Excel involves several key components. Understanding these components is crucial for creating a system that meets your business needs and enhances operational efficiency.
1. Product Database
The product database is the foundation of your inventory management system. It contains essential information about each product, which may include:
| Field | Description |
|---|---|
| SKU | Stock Keeping Unit, a unique identifier for each product. |
| Name | The name of the product. |
| Description | A brief description of the product. |
| Category | The category to which the product belongs. |
| Supplier | The name of the supplier providing the product. |
2. Stock Levels
Tracking stock levels is critical for maintaining inventory. This component includes:
- Current Stock: The number of units currently available.
- Minimum Stock Level: The lowest quantity of stock that should be maintained to avoid stockouts.
- Reorder Point: The stock level at which new orders should be placed to replenish inventory.
3. Sales Tracking
Sales tracking is vital for understanding product performance. This component should include:
- Date of Sale: The date when the product was sold.
- Quantity Sold: The number of units sold in each transaction.
- Sales Price: The price at which the product was sold.
- Customer Information: Details about the customer making the purchase.
4. Supplier Management
Managing supplier information is essential for maintaining good relationships and ensuring timely deliveries. This component includes:
| Field | Description |
|---|---|
| Supplier Name | The name of the supplier. |
| Contact Information | Phone number and email address for communication. |
| Lead Time | The time it takes for the supplier to deliver products after an order is placed. |
| Payment Terms | The agreed-upon terms for payment (e.g., net 30 days). |
5. Reporting and Analytics
Reporting and analytics are crucial for making informed business decisions. This component should provide:
- Inventory Reports: Regular reports on stock levels, including overstock and stockout situations.
- Sales Reports: Insights into sales trends, helping to identify best-selling products.
- Turnover Rates: Analysis of how quickly inventory is sold and replaced over a specific period.

Common Problems and Misconceptions in Building an Inventory Management System in Excel
While building an inventory management system in Excel can be beneficial, there are several common problems, risks, and misconceptions that users may encounter. Understanding these issues and how to address them is crucial for effective inventory management.
1. Data Entry Errors
One of the most significant risks in using Excel for inventory management is data entry errors. These can lead to inaccurate stock levels and poor decision-making.
- Common Causes: Manual data entry, lack of standardized formats, and human error.
- Solutions: Implement data validation rules in Excel to restrict entries to specific formats. Use drop-down lists for categories and suppliers to minimize errors.
2. Lack of Real-Time Updates
Many users believe that Excel can provide real-time inventory tracking, but this is often not the case.
- Common Misconception: Excel automatically updates inventory levels in real-time.
- Solutions: Establish a routine for updating inventory levels, such as daily or weekly checks. Consider using Excel’s built-in features like macros to automate updates where possible.
3. Limited Scalability
As businesses grow, their inventory management needs become more complex. Some users mistakenly believe that Excel can handle unlimited growth.
- Common Issue: Excel may become slow or cumbersome with large datasets.
- Solutions: Regularly archive old data to keep the spreadsheet manageable. If the dataset grows too large, consider transitioning to specialized inventory management software.
4. Inadequate Reporting
Users often underestimate the importance of reporting capabilities in an inventory management system.
- Common Misconception: Excel can easily generate comprehensive reports without additional setup.
- Solutions: Invest time in learning Excel’s advanced functions, such as pivot tables and charts, to create meaningful reports. Set up templates for regular reporting to streamline the process.
5. Security Risks
Excel files can be vulnerable to unauthorized access and data loss, which is a common concern for businesses.
- Common Issue: Users often do not implement adequate security measures.
- Solutions: Use password protection for sensitive files and regularly back up data to prevent loss. Consider using cloud storage solutions that offer additional security features.

Main Methods, Frameworks, and Tools for Building an Inventory Management System in Excel
Building an inventory management system in Excel can be enhanced through various methods, frameworks, and tools. These resources can streamline processes, improve accuracy, and facilitate better decision-making.
1. Methods for Inventory Management
Several methods can be employed to optimize inventory management in Excel:
- First-In, First-Out (FIFO): This method ensures that the oldest inventory items are sold first, which is particularly useful for perishable goods.
- Last-In, First-Out (LIFO): This approach assumes that the most recently acquired inventory is sold first, which can be beneficial in times of rising prices.
- Just-In-Time (JIT): JIT inventory management minimizes holding costs by ordering stock only as needed, reducing excess inventory.
2. Frameworks for Structuring Inventory Data
Using frameworks can help organize and structure inventory data effectively:
- Inventory Turnover Ratio: This framework measures how quickly inventory is sold and replaced over a specific period, helping businesses assess efficiency.
- ABC Analysis: This categorization method divides inventory into three categories (A, B, C) based on value and importance, allowing businesses to prioritize management efforts.
- Economic Order Quantity (EOQ): This formula helps determine the optimal order quantity that minimizes total inventory costs, including holding and ordering costs.
3. Tools to Enhance Excel Inventory Management
Several tools can enhance the functionality of Excel for inventory management:
| Tool | Description |
|---|---|
| Excel Add-Ins | Various add-ins can extend Excel’s capabilities, such as inventory tracking templates and data analysis tools. |
| Macros | Macros can automate repetitive tasks, such as updating stock levels or generating reports, saving time and reducing errors. |
| Power Query | This tool allows users to connect, combine, and refine data from various sources, making it easier to manage large datasets. |
| Power Pivot | Power Pivot enables advanced data modeling and analysis, allowing users to create complex reports and dashboards. |

Frequently Asked Questions (FAQs)
1. Can I use Excel for large-scale inventory management?
While Excel can handle moderate-sized inventories, it may become cumbersome for very large datasets. Consider transitioning to specialized inventory management software if your business scales significantly.
2. How can I prevent data entry errors in Excel?
Implement data validation rules, use drop-down lists for consistent entries, and regularly audit your data to minimize errors.
3. Is it possible to automate inventory updates in Excel?
Yes, you can use macros to automate repetitive tasks, such as updating stock levels and generating reports, which can save time and reduce errors.
